Details of Action

+
1. Meeting all applicable requirements of the Knox County Dept. of Engineering and Public Works
2. Widen Harmon Rd. to a minimum paved width of 20'. This road widening is to be done prior to or in conjunction with the development of any portion of this site. Road widening plans must be reviewed and approved by the Knox County Dept. of Engineering and Public Works before any construction begins on this project
3. All retaining walls greater than 4' in height must be designed by a registered engineer
4. Note on the plan that all intersection grades up to 3% have been approved by the Knox County Dept. of Engineering and Public Works
5. Certify 300' of sight distance in both directions at the Harmon Rd. entrance and at all three driveway entrances to the condominiums
6. Place a note on the final plat that lots 1-32 will have access from the internal street system to Arthur Harmon Rd. only
7. Connection to sanitary sewer and meeting all other applicable requirements of the Knox County Health Dept.
8. Provision of street names which are consistent with the Uniform Street naming and Addressing System in Knox County (Ord. 91-1-102)
9. Meeting all applicable requirements and obtaining all required permits from the Tenn. Dept. of Environment and Conservation
10. Meeting all requirements of the approved use on review development plan
